    When playing favorites I personally try to make sure when I make a play that I am getting as close to even odds as possible..that way if I do lose it, it ends up not killing my bank. Keep in mind you can easily hit a dog play that pays 2-3x your money(if not more), and it happens frequently... rarely do I ever risk more than 2-3 units just to win 1 unit on heavy favs... so if you are making a 2-3 person parlay with heavy chalk make sure you aren't having to risk your ass just to make a unit.... Just my 2 cents.. good luck with whatever plays you choose

    laying big chalk is very risky (especially if you are trying to win 2 or 3 units, there are only a handful of players I would ever lay big chalk with (-500 and up)

    basically Nadal on clay is the only FOR SURE bet I'd ever make, though with his injuries and etc. now that's very risky if its really really big chalk
